12055 Longbrook Dr Houston Texas USA
Assisted Living Facility in Texas
14655 Preston Rd Dallas USA
7405 Hillwood Lane Dallas USA
7210 Duffield Dr Dallas USA
5850 Ohio Drive Frisco USA